What The Florida Building Code Expects From Replacement Windows
The Florida Building Code sets the baseline for replacement windows in this area.
Florida product approval impact windows documentation shows that the unit has been tested and approved for use under Florida standards.
In some cases, hurricane rated windows Seminole County FL homeowners choose are designed to replace shutters or other temporary protection methods. Regular windows may meet basic code in some settings, but impact-rated products add a layer of protection that can simplify storm prep.

Common Problems That Slow Down Approval
The inspection is where the work gets verified on site.
If the crew cannot show the right approval paperwork, the inspector may not be able to sign off.
Fasteners, flashing, sealant, shimming, and opening prep all have to be done correctly. A proper inspection helps separate a product defect from a workmanship problem.
